KIM v. U.S.

No. CV-92-4920 (CPS).

822 F.Supp. 107 (1993)

Hun Jong KIM, Plaintiff, v. UNITED STATES of America et ano., Defendants.

United States District Court, E.D. New York.

May 7, 1993.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Richard A. Izzo, Denver, CO, for plaintiff.

Mary Jo White, U.S. Atty., Eastern District of New York by Claire S. Kedeshian, Asst. U.S. Atty., Brooklyn, NY, for defendants.


MEMORANDUM AND ORDER

SIFTON, District Judge.

Plaintiff, Hun Jong Kim, as proprietor of Kim's Family Market, commenced this action pursuant to 7 U.S.C. § 2023(a) seeking judicial review of a final determination by the Food and Nutrition Service ("FNS") disqualifying plaintiff as a vendor under the food stamp program for a period of three years.
